Jaundiced Eye by William Saunderson-Meyer has been dissecting SA politics for three decades, making it the longest-running column of its kind. WSM's insights are applied to good use in this interview, where he picks up on his friend RW Johnson's warning about Russian influence in SA's watershed 2024 election and shares thoughts on the Eskom disaster; the SA president's long-delayed but still pending cabinet reshuffle; and chances of the country avoiding a "disastrous" ANC/EFF coalition after next year's poll. He spoke to Alec Hogg of BizNews. Learn more about your ad choices. Visit megaphone.fm/adchoices
